It looks like Chelsea boss Antonio Conte has finally found his frontman for the next season as the Blues are close to securing a deal with Real Madrid for Alvaro Morata.

 

Chelsea are currently without a striker amongst their ranks. Antonio Conte has already shown the door to his current striker Diego Costa and has also missed out on Romelu Lukaku – his prime summer target. And with each passing day, it looks as if Chelsea were piling on the pressure upon themselves. There were numerous reports linking Dortmund’s Aubameyang to Chelsea. Many sources also claimed that a deal had already been agreed between the two clubs and the Gabon International was all set to join the Blues.

And in the past few days, there were also reports that Chelsea were looking to sign Sergio Aguero from Manchester City. City boss Pep Guardiola had apparently given a green signal to the deal and the Argentine looked all set to move to London.

But now according to journalist Gianluca Di Marzio, Chelsea have shifted their focus to Alvaro Morata, and the Spaniard is pretty close to signing for the Blues.

Alvaro Morata was initially set to move to Manchester United before the Red Devils decided to sign Romelu Lukaku. And now it looks as if the Chelsea boss is trying to make things even by signing up Morata.
